A few months after its launch in France in May 2001, the
ViaMichelin website was already recognised as a major player in
digital mobility support services: 2 to 3 million visitors a month,
60,000 Newsletter subscribers to its Tourism, Gastronomy and
Automobile magazine.

Ten years later, the ViaMichelin.com
site is:

  • Available in 8 languages (German, English, Spanish, French,
    Italian, Dutch, Polish, Portuguese)
  • coverage of more than 90 countries worldwide,
  • 2.7 billion total visits,
  • 1,200 billion route kilometres calculated,
  • More than 15 billion maps displayed,
  • a record audience with more than 10 million visits for one week
    commencing 26th July 2010,
  • 1.3 million subscribers for its Tourism, Gastronomy and
     Automobile magazine,
  • almost 50,000 hotel room nights booked each month,
  • a new travel channel (Travel.ViaMichelin.com) dedicated to the
    preparation of made-to-measure travel and based on the content of
    the Michelin Green Guide collection,
  • a Facebook page « Michelin Travel » for sharing
    travel tips,
  • specific features related to current events: the fall of the
    Berlin Wall, Winter Sports, Mondial de L’Automobile, World Cup
    football, etc.

Throughout the years, the editorial team has continued to enrich
the content of the ViaMichelin website in order to enable web users
to discover unusual regions and unearth exceptional products that
are worth a detour.

ViaMichelin continues to develop its online and mobile support
offerings  in 2011, providing travel assistance services that
will help users in their everyday lives, before and during their
travels and upon arrival at a destination.

About ViaMichelin

A 100% owned subsidiary of the Michelin Group, ViaMichelin
designs, develops and markets digital products and services to
support the mobility of road users in Europe. Building on a century
of Michelin expertise in the field of travel, this activity,
launched in 2001, addresses both business and the general public.
It offers a comprehensive range of services (hotel booking,
restaurants, traffic information, tourism, etc), accessible through
multiple media: Internet, mobile phones including iPhones,
navigation systems, etc. In 2010, a new travel channel entirely
dedicated to made to measure travel preparation and based on the
contents of the Michelin Green Guide was added to enrich the travel
assistance website href="www.ViaMichelin.com">www.ViaMichelin.com
